WebThings that gush come streaming out. Water can gush out of a hose or a drinking fountain, and you can also call the jet of water itself a gush. A more figurative way to gush is to talk enthusiastically about something — you might gush … Web[transitive] gush something (of a container/vehicle etc.) to suddenly let out large amounts of a liquid The tanker was gushing oil. (figurative) She absolutely gushed enthusiasm. [transitive, intransitive] (+ speech) (disapproving) to express so much praise or emotion about somebody/something that it does not seem sincere
